Room was super comfortable. Beds were outstanding. The hotel is a great place to cool off during 37 degree heat. Can hear a bit of corridor noise from the room that would be my only niggle. Lifts are super quick and silent - feels like you haven't gone up or down even though you have. The breakfast spread is very comprehensive and well stocked. The bar is also very well stocked and has almost anything you would want. The garden area is beautiful and so nice to sit in and relax. The spa is amazing - it was included with my diamond membership and we loved it. The pool, hydrotherapy pool, sauna and steam rooms were just a brilliant way to spend a few hours.

Stayed 2 nights. Friendly receptionist. The room is clean and has decent space for storing 2 big suitcases. Plenty amount of food selection for breakfast. Spacious free parking within walking distance. The only minor thing is that there’s no door or curtain for shower and floor can be very wet.

Fantastic place to get away. The staff are a joy and make you feel very welcome. Be aware though that children under 16 are not allowed in the pool or spa facilities. It does not tell you this when booking a family room, even after entering the age of the child. This particular policy is on the lower portion of the spa page on the website and not obvious at all when booking.
